Susie Nam

CEO of the Americas, Droga5

As CEO of the Americas, Susie is at the helm of Droga5 New York, supporting client business across North and South America. Since joining the agency 13 years ago, Susie has been instrumental in the agency’s significant growth from a 35-person crew into a team of more than 500+ employees. She has also been critical in designing systems and culture that yield breakthrough ideas and advance best-in-class talent.

She began her career at George magazine, following the presidential campaign trail, and served as Features Editor for The New York Times’ first-ever online edition before studying at the London School of Economics. She then landed in advertising—first with Fallon, then with Droga5 in 2009.
Susie is an Aspen Institute First Movers Fellow (2020) and has been part of the GoldHouse A100 (2018) and Adweek 50 (2017). She’s also consistently served as an executive leader, champion and advocate for diversity, equity and inclusion. She is the founder and executive advisor of Droga5’s diversity, equity and inclusion initiative, D+iQ, and serves as Vice Chair of the board of directors of ADCOLOR, the premier organization celebrating and promoting professionals of color in the creative industries.
